ASCEND_LOG_DEVICE_FLUSH_TIMEOUT
功能描述
业务进程退出前,系统有2000ms的默认延时将Device侧应用类日志回传到Host侧,超时后业务进程退出。未回传到Host侧的日志直接在Device侧落盘(路径为/var/log/npu/slog)。
Device侧应用类日志回传到Host侧的延时时间可以通过环境变量ASCEND_LOG_DEVICE_FLUSH_TIMEOUT进行设置。
环境变量取值范围为[0, 180000],单位为ms,默认值为2000。
- 设置的值仅在当前shell下生效。
- 通过执行echo $ASCEND_LOG_DEVICE_FLUSH_TIMEOUT命令可以查看环境变量设置的值。
- 若环境变量未配置或配置为非法值或配置为空,表示采用日志默认值。
- 如果业务进程不需要等待所有Device侧应用类日志回传到Host侧,可将环境变量设置为0。
- 针对业务进程退出后仍然有Device侧应用类日志未回传到Host侧这种情况,建议设置更大的延时时间,具体调节的大小可以根据device-app-pid的日志内容进行判断。
配置示例
export ASCEND_LOG_DEVICE_FLUSH_TIMEOUT=5000
是否必选
否
使用约束
无
支持的型号
Atlas 200/300/500 推理产品
Atlas 训练系列产品
Atlas 推理系列产品
Atlas A2训练系列产品
Atlas 200/500 A2推理产品
父主题: 日志